Diagram of the Nervous System

par Jorge Arizpe
1 It is the system that recieves, processes and stores information. It coordinates the responses of the organism to internal and external stimuli. 2 It is the part of the nervous system formed by the brain and the spinal cord 3 It is the part of the Nervous System formed by the nerves that connect the central nervous system with the organs of the senses (eyes, ears and skin) and with other organs of the body as muscles, blood vesseles and glands. 4 It is the part of the Central Nervous System that is protected by the cranium. It is made up of gray and white matter. Thinking is generated on it. and it also coordinates physiological responses. 5 It is part of the Central Nervous System. It starts in the Medulla Oblongata and goes trough the spine. The nerves that go to the different systems of the body come from it. 6 type of neuron that carries impulses from the peripheral organs to the Central Nervous System. 7 Type of neuron that carries impulses from the central nervous system to muscles glands and tissues 8 Part of the Nervous System responsible of sensation and skeletal muscle control 9 Part of the Nervous System formed by nerves and galglia that innervate blood vessels, heart, entrails and glands. Its control is involuntary. It is divided into Sympathetic and Para-Sympathetic Nervous System. 10 Part of the Autonomic Nervous System that inhibits the processes of the parasympathetic nervous system, reduces gastric secrections, elevates heart rithym and contracts blood vessels 11 It is the part of the autonomic nervous system that inhibits the processes of the sympathetic nervous system. It increases the digestive secrections, lowers the heart rithym, etc.
